The book offers a detailed description of life on the self-organizing, self-governing and self-informing commons, including spiritual practices and traditions

Rich in historical detail, the book uncovers a denigrated piece of history, selectively culls elements that could be usefully revived today and ends with a vision in which some promising current initiatives, such as permaculture and the Occupy Movement, take on a deeper significance.

This is an engaging memoir of personal and political discovery, and maintains its intimate voice throughout

Part I is pure memoir in its intimate account of the author unearthing a lost heritage around the commons and the real tragedy of its loss

Part II identifies key commons practices that could be usefully revived today, and the capacity building that this would require

A final 'manifesto' section pulls these together into a vision for reclaiming the commons, making reference to a number of initiatives going on now, including in local food security, permaculture and the Occupy Movement, that are already re-inventing the commons and reviving its ethos of mutual respect and empathy.

This book is different from other titles with regard to the historical perspective Menzies brings to the contemporary discussion about alternatives and bringing them into being.
